Despite the decline in caries prevalence in the last two decades, there is a small part of population that accounts for a large number of caries lesions that, if not treated, may result in dental loss and dental arch reduction, causing damage that may affect the stomatognathic system equilibrium. Space main- tainers may avoid such a situation, however, for the treatment success, they should be correctly prescribed. This work aimed to discuss some aspects of space maintenance after early loss of primary teeth and provide directions to clini- cians working with children. This literature review suggests that a decrease in the length of the den- tal arch is usually observed after early loss of primary teeth and the space maintenance is of great importance to the patient.
